On Sunday, the first day of the tenth session of the World Urban Forum (WUF10) in Abu Dhabi, Ugochi Daniels, the UN Resident Coordinator and Mehmet Emin Akdogan, Chief of UN-Habitat Tehran Office met Pirouz Hanachi, Mayor of Tehran, in a joint meeting and discussed urban challenges that Tehran Metropolis is facing these days.
Organized by the United Nations Human Settlements Program, the Forum is recognized as one of the most widely held international forums and is considered as an opportunity to exchange ideas and experiences on urban challenges.
This year, the Forum brought together more than 25000 international visitors, including local and regional professionals and city managers.
